30-31 Emergency Brake Cross Shaft I am trying to put together the parts for a chassis. I have an Emergency Brake cross shaft that someone cut off the end of the passenger side lever arm. I bought a pair at the Fletcher,NC swap yesterday. The arms were different lengths than the one I had. It is almost impossible to read the part number of the arm.
1. 2 3/4 in from center of shaft to center of arm where the clevis and cotter goes. 2. 3 1/2 in from the same points on the other arm. I cannot find a reason in the Restoration Guidelines. Does anyone know why and possibly the timeline for the part differences. Thanks. Vic |
Re: 30-31 Emergency Brake Cross Shaft I measured some I have and they are 2 3/4".
